What is Ferrous Fumarate?

Ferrous fumarate is an iron supplement commonly prescribed to treat or prevent iron deficiency anemia. It is a type of iron salt that is well-absorbed by the body. This supplement is particularly beneficial for individuals who have low iron levels due to dietary deficiencies, pregnancy, or certain medical conditions.

Recommended Dosage: 210 mg Three Times a Day

For many adults, the recommended dosage of ferrous fumarate can vary based on individual needs. A typical dosage is 210 mg taken three times a day, which amounts to a total of 630 mg of ferrous fumarate daily. This dosage helps to restore iron levels effectively and efficiently. However, it’s crucial to consult with a healthcare provider before starting any new supplement regimen, as individual needs may vary based on age, sex, and health status.

How to Take Ferrous Fumarate for Maximum Absorption

To maximize the benefits of ferrous fumarate, consider the following tips:

1. Take with Vitamin C

Vitamin C enhances the absorption of iron. Taking ferrous fumarate with a glass of orange juice or a vitamin C supplement can significantly improve iron uptake.

2. Avoid Certain Foods and Medications

Certain foods (like dairy products, coffee, and tea) and medications can inhibit iron absorption. It’s advisable to take ferrous fumarate at least two hours apart from these substances for optimal results.

3. Consistent Timing

Taking ferrous fumarate at the same times each day can help establish a routine, ensuring you don’t miss a dose and maintain consistent iron levels in your body.

Potential Side Effects

While ferrous fumarate is generally safe, it may cause some side effects, especially when taken in higher doses. Common side effects include gastrointestinal discomfort, constipation, and dark stools. If you experience severe side effects or allergic reactions, it’s important to seek medical attention immediately.
